What is Energy Trading?
Energy trading is the practice of buying and selling key energy commodities such as crude oil, natural gas, heating oil, and ethanol on the global market. These resources are vital for industries, transportation, and households, making them some of the most actively traded assets worldwide. Price movements in energy markets reflect changes in global supply, demand, and geopolitical stability. By trading energy, investors can hedge against inflation, diversify their portfolios, and take advantage of short- and long-term market opportunities. Factors such as OPEC decisions, weather conditions, technological developments, and government energy policies have a significant impact on energy prices. Energy trading involves buying and selling energy commodities such as crude oil, natural gas, electricity, and renewable energy certificates on global markets. These assets play a critical role in powering industries, transportation, and households, making them some of the most actively traded commodities worldwide. Instead of physically holding the energy resource, most traders participate through financial instruments such as futures, options, and CFDs (Contracts for Difference). These tools allow market participants to speculate on price movements, hedge exposure, or manage supply risks without needing to store or transport the underlying energy. Prices in energy markets are influenced by factors such as geopolitical events, supply and demand dynamics, production levels, seasonal consumption trends, and macroeconomic indicators. Energy trading enables investors to seize opportunities created by market volatility while diversifying their broader investment strategies.
